MAIL NOTICES.
WEDNESDAY, JUNE 19
For Napier and Southern Offices, per Tarawera, 6 p.m.
’ For Auckland (Mniir Trunk), per Tarawera, 6 p.m.' For Auckland and Tokomaru Bay, per Mokoia 6 p.m. meantime.
For United States of America, Canada, Cook Islands, Tahiti, West Indies, Central America, West Coast of South America, West Coast of South America ; also, United Kingdom and Continent of Europe, via San Francisco (due in London July 22) connecting with s-s. Manuka at Wellington, per Tarawera, 6 p.m. Correspondence for Continent of Europe must be specially addressed via ’Frisco.
For Australia (due in Sydney June 25) Ceylon, India, Mauritius, Straits Settlements, China, Japan, and Philippine Islands; also Continent of Europe and United Kingdom, via Suez (due in London July 281 connecting with s.s. Maunganui at Wellington,- per Tarawera, 0 p.m. Correspondence for United Kingdom must he specially addressed via Suez.. SATURDAY,. JUNE 22. For Auckland and Tokomaru Bay, per Victoria, -9 a.m. For Australia and South Africa, per’ Victoria, 9 a.m. Parcel mail for United Kingdom connecting with . s.s. Ruapehu at Welling~ton, per Mokoia, 5 p.m. SUNDAY, JUNE 23. For Napier and Southern Offices, per Mokoia, 4 p.m. For Auckland (Main Trunk) per Molcoia, 4 p.m. . For United Kingdom and Continent of Europe, via London (due in London August 9) for specially-addressed correspondence only; also South America and Canary Islands, connecting with s.s. Ruapehu at Wellington, per Mokoia 4 p.m. W. H. RENNER, Chief-Postmaster.
